    Email this to me.

    > Featured Rides Checklist:

    10+ Pictures taken with a 3MP+ Digital Camera (Exterior, Interior, Trunk, Engine...)

    6-12 paragraph article written in third person. Don't just write a history of your car try to make it interesting and different. Write about how it handles and what the modifications have improved and whatever else you think should go in there.

    Modifications list categorized by ( Performance / Audio & Visual / Control / Show)

    Any extra's such as Dyno sheets, 0-60mph times, track times...
